CPCB Multi-Year History (2016–2024)
Summary
Overview
In 2024, Bareilly averaged an AQI of 61 while Bhubaneswar averaged 115 — a 54-point (89%) gap, with Bhubaneswar the more polluted and Bareilly the cleaner of the two. On 357 days when both cities reported, Bareilly was cleaner on 282 of them; the average daily gap was 69 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Bareilly peaks in November, while Bhubaneswar peaks in January. Bareilly logged 0% Severe days and 73.1%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Bhubaneswar was 0% Severe and 48.8%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Bareilly 51 days, Bhubaneswar 27 days.
Year-over-year progress
The worst recorded day for Bareilly reached AQI 292 at Rajendra Nagar (UPPCB) on 2022-11-03; Bhubaneswar hit AQI 341 at Lingraj Mandir (OSPCB) on 2024-01-09.
Station-level disparity
Bareilly spans 2 CPCB stations with a 12-point spread (min 71, max 83); Bhubaneswar spans 2 stations with a 2-point spread (min 114, max 116).
